Core Innovation

This paper presents STATIC, which transforms irregular trie traversals into vectorized sparse matrix operations by flattening prefix trees into a static CSR matrix. This approach unlocks massive efficiency gains on hardware accelerators, achieving orders of magnitude speedup over CPU and binary-search baselines while maintaining strict output constraints during LLM decoding.

Why It Matters

Industrial recommender systems require output constraints to enforce business rules like content freshness or category restrictions, which standard decoding methods struggle to support efficiently. STATIC reduces latency drastically while maintaining strict constraints, enabling scalable, real-time generative retrieval that improves recommendation relevance and user experience at massive scale.
